Art Deco Walnut, Briar Root and Ebonized Beech Sideboard, Italy

About the Item

Made in Italy, 1940s. This stunning and elegant sideboard is made in walnut, briar root and ebonized beech and features bachelite handles. It is a vintage item, therefore it might show slight traces of use, but it can be considered as in excellent original condition as it's been recently restored. Measures: Width 190 cm Depth 52 cm Height 92 cm. Order it now!
